Suppose we cut a line connecting
two opposite vertices of a rectangle
dividing the figure into two similar
parts.

The two similar parts formed from
cutting the rectangle are triangles
which share the common side
(represented by the broken lines)
called the diagonal of the rectangle.
10. A polygon is a closed figure
made up of several line
segments that are joined
together. The line segments
are called sides and do not
cross each other. There are
exactly two sides that meet
at a point.
11. A triangle is a polygon with
3 sides and 3 angles.
A quadrilateral is a
polygon with 4 sides and 4
angles.

The total measure of all the angles
of a triangle is equal to 180 degrees
of interior angles and 360 degrees of
interior angles for a quadrilateral.

20. Here are the properties of a quadrilateral.
A quadrilateral has four line
segments. The line segment is a
line formed by connecting two
consecutive vertices. A line written
at the top of two letters denotes a
line segment.
Quadrilateral LOVE contains line
Segments LO , OV , VE, and LE.
21. It has four vertices. Vertices are
presented with an upper case
letter of the corresponding vertex
or endpoint. Quadrilateral LOVE
contains vertices which are L, O,
V, and E.

22. It has four angles. An angle is a
figure formed by two consecutive
sides with a common vertex.
Quadrilateral LOVE contains ∠L,
∠O, ∠V, and ∠E.

23. It has two pairs of opposite sides.
Quadrilateral LOVE contains LOand
EV which are opposite sides, and LE
and OV which are also opposite.

It has adjacent sides. Adjacent sides are
two lines that meet at a common endpoint
or vertex. They can also be considered
consecutive sides. In Quadrilateral LOVE,
LO and LE have a common vertex, L so LO
and LE are adjacent sides. OL and OV are
also adjacent sides.
25. If exactly one pair of
opposite sides of a
quadrilateral is parallel it is
a trapezoid.The line that at
some point never intersect or
does not meet is called
parallel line.

In Quadrilateral PART, PA and
RT do not intersect, that means that
PA and RT are parallel. Therefore,
Figure PART is a trapezoid.
27. If the two nonparallel sides
of a trapezoid are congruent,
it is called an isosceles
trapezoid. In geometry, two
figures or objects are
congruent if and only if they
have the same or equal
measurement.

In trapezoid PLAN, the nonparallel
sides, PN and LA, are the same or
congruent. So quadrilateral PLAN
is an isosceles trapezoid.
29. If two pairs of opposite sides
are parallel, it is a
parallelogram. In a
parallelogram, if the parallel
sides have the same measure
or equal they are considered as
congruent.

In quadrilateral CARE, CA is parallel to ER
and CE is parallel to AR . So, Quadrilateral
CARE is a parallelogram.
31. If the angles ofa parallelogram
are right angles, the parallelogram
is a rectangle. In parallelogram
ROLE, RO is parallel to LE and RE is
parallel to OL. ∠R, ∠O, ∠L, and ∠E are
right angles. Thus, parallelogram
ROLE is a rectangle. All the angles in
a rectangle are congruent. In addition,
the parallel sides are congruent; RO
has the same measure or congruent
to LE and REthe same measure to OL.
32. Also, all adjacent sides are
Perpendicular; RO⊥ OL, RO⊥ RE,
LE⊥ OL,LE ⊥ RE. (When all lines
intersect and form a
right angle it is called perpendicular.
We used the symbol ⊥ for
perpendicular.)

A square is a rectangle with all sides are
the same or congruent. Figure SAFE,is a
rectangle with four congruent sides, SA has
the same measure or congruent to AF, AF
has the same measure to FE, and FE has the
same measure to ES. ∠S, ∠A, ∠F, and ∠E
all measures 90° or right angles. Thus, it is
a square.
34. If all the sides of a parallelogram are
congruent, it is a rhombus. See Figure
TAKE, it is a rhombus because the
opposite sides are congruent and all sides
are parallel. In a rhombus, the four angles
need not to be congruent or the same.

35. If the angles in a rhombus are all right
angles, then the rhombus is a square. In
rhombus JUST, ∠J, ∠U, ∠S, ∠T are right
angles which measures 90°. Hence, it is
also a square. A square may also be
defined as a rhombus in which all angles
are right angles.
